Hi, I bought this pre-built pc from Amazon (https://www.amazon.com/gp/product/B09DHTWR5N/ref=ppx_yo_dt_b_asin_title_o02_s00?ie=UTF8&th=1) almost two years ago and I began having this problem when I started playing baldurs gate 3. When I was playing the game one night the monitor suddenly turned off saying that it had no signal, but my PC was still running because I could hear Discord voice chat and game audio still being played. I can only use my computer again after I restart the PC manually using the power button. I thought it was just a one-time thing so I kept playing the game, but my playtime would get shorter and shorter as I was still having the same problem with the monitors shutting off, but pc still being clearly on. The problem has gotten worse throughout the week as I can't open any games that use the GPU now without the monitors turning off on the start screen or just a few minutes playing it. Cpu related games still work fine like League of Legends.

I tried the following to fix it without replacing any parts, but I'm running out of ideas and I think it might be a hardware issue. So any help from people who encountered a similar issue and what did you to fix it would be great.



Tried fixes:
- Update bios to the latest one F9 I believe from gigabyte
- Use ddu to reinstall nvidia drivers
- Undervolted my gpu
- Replacing the thermal paste (Haven't done this yet, but idle temp for gpu is 40-50c while highest temp for playing a game while it was still letting me play a little bit is 75c.) so heat doesn't seem like the issue?

Here's the full pc specs:
Motherboard: Gigabyte B560 DS3H AC ATX LGA1200
Processor: Intel Core-i5 11600KF 3.9 Ghz 6-Core/12-Thread
Graphics: Gigabyte GeForce RTX 3060 Gaming OC 12G (rev. 2.0)
RAM: TeamGroup T-Force Vulcan Z 16GB (2 x 8GB) DDR4-3200 CL16
Storage: Western Digital Blue SN570 500 GB M.2 2280 NVMe SSD; Seagate BarraCuda 1 TB 3.5” 7200RPM HDD
Case: CyberPowerPC Onyxia II 242W w/ (4x) CyberPowerPC-branded 120mm ARGB Fans and APEVIA ARGB Controller w/ remote
CPU Cooler: Cooler Master i71C Low-Profile Heatsink w/ 120mm ARGB Fan
PSU: Thermaltake SMART 600-Watt 80+ Gold ATX
